New Linux mint user I know ZERO. by [deleted] in linuxmint

[–]AtomicBlueElephant 1 point2 points  (0 children)

I can tell you my experience and what I've done. I'm in about the same boat.

I went to youtube and searched for computer science terminology. There are quite a few, but freecodecamp has some that will give you basics.

There's also the Harvard CS50 course. The whole course is available on YouTube or you can go to edx and take it for free. There's also an edx course called Introduction to Linux. It has helped a lot. These options require time and work and aren't quick fixes. I prefer this. You might not but they have helped me.

You dont need to know everything right up front. I did the same, deleted Windows and the safety net. There are some videos about customizing cinnamon, start there and first learn to install apps, learn update and upgrade, sudo apt install, etc. Look up what the commands mean everytime you need to use one, and keep a notebook.

And be patient. It can be confusing.
